Q. OVERMEN? LIFE INSURANCE, Principal features as compared with other offices : Ist,—lnviolable Security—the security of the Nation. 2nd,-Lower Eates. The premiums are from 15 to 30 per cent lower than other offices, A policy for £llsO to £1250 can be secured in the Government Office for the same amount as would secure £IOOO only in other offices. 3rd,—All Profits divided among the Insuredonly. 4th.—Policies now forfeited for one year after the due date of premium and after three years a paid-up policy can bo obtained for an amount largerthaii the premiums paid; • ■ ■ ■ ■ sth.—Policy-holders can Borrow 90 per cent of the surrender value of their policies at 7 percent interest. 6th. -Settlement Policies absolutely proi tceted from Bankruptcy.
